To Hailey on her Baptism Day



A long time ago, But not long at all
You made a choice, and accepted a call
You wanted to come to earth so you be
Like Heavenly Father for eternity

He kissed you and then put you on his lap.
He gave you some gifts and showed you a map.
He told you that you must walk a straight path,
And if you chose the right, you’d find your way back.

Your journey will be rocky; the road will be long,
Sometimes the choices you make will be wrong.
Your feet will grow weary; the light may grow dim,
But these gifts would bring you home to him.

One of the gifts God gave to you
Were parents to love you and sisters too.
And when you were born, we were given the task
To raise you and teach you to find the right path

We taught you to walk; we held your hand,
And showed you the many the roads in the land.
We gave you directions, and showed you the way
To follow the map God gave you that day.

Now you are eight and today is the day
To draw your own map and find your own way.
You will make mistakes and you may get lost
But Jesus has already paid the cost.

And through his sacrifice you will be
Given a bridge to cross the streams.
Your baptism washes away the road grime,
And if you repent, you’ll stay clean all the time.

Your confirmation will help you hear
The whispers of His voice in your ear.
It will help you to know which way to choose
And when you get frightened, it will comfort you.

But though they are gifts, they have a small price
And you must be willing to sacrifice.
And make to him promises that you’ll obey
And keep all the covenants you make today.

You have chosen the path you will take
You start your own journey, your choice you make.
Your choice is eternal and the Lord knows
How much you love him, and your faith shows.

Your father in heaven is happy today
That you have accepted the gifts that he gave.
Today you’ll be perfect, but you won’t always be
But Hailey, you’ll always be perfect to me.
